A Sweet Aroma
A comic strip character in Peanuts, nicknamed Pigpen, kicked up a cloud of dust wherever he went. He wasn’t the most popular kid, as you can imagine, but he occasionally came up with something wise to say. I wonder what kind of cloud we kick up as we walk through life. Is it a dust cloud that chokes people and causes them to want to run away, or do we emanate a more pleasing atmosphere?
As Christians, we might kick up dust sometimes, but 2 Corinthians 2:15-16 (NIV) gives us a better idea of what we should leave in our wake: ‘For we are to God the pleasing aroma of Christ among those who are being saved and those who are perishing. To the one we are an aroma that brings death; to the other, an aroma that brings life. And who is equal to such a task?’ Who indeed?
In a book on contemplative prayer, the author commented that in union with Christ, we can release the fragrance of Christ wherever we go. It’s even possible to do this for those who don’t know him and want nothing to do with him. 1 Peter 3:15 reminds us to talk to people about Jesus with gentleness and respect, humility and reverence. We can spread a pleasing aroma of Christ when we are in union with him, surrendered to him and aware of the effect we have on others.
May we always have a positive effect and a sweet aroma through the kindness and compassion of Christ in our lives.
